What is a 20 Foot Shipping Container?
A 20-foot shipping container is a standardized intermodal container that is developed for the transportation and storage of cargo. Its size makes it a popular option for different markets, whether for shipping goods throughout oceans or for on-site storage options. The dimensions may vary slightly however follow worldwide shipping requirements.

Uses of 20 Foot Shipping Containers
The 20-foot shipping container is extremely flexible and serves a wide range of functions, including:
Shipping: Primarily used for transporting items by sea, rail, and roadway.Storage Solutions: Commonly utilized for on-site storage for services and families.Modular Construction: Converted into portable workplaces, homes, and pop-up shops.Recreational Uses: Suitable for transforming into portable activities like bars, coffee shops, and even pool.Transporting Vehicles: Designed to securely carry boats, automobiles, and other machinery.Advantages of 20 Foot Shipping Containers
The popularity of shipping containers can be credited to numerous elements, such as:
Cost-Effective: Generally more cost effective than other storage choices.Durability: Made from strong steel product developed to withstand extreme weather condition.Portability: Easily moved by truck, ship, or rail.Security: Lockable doors supply a safe and secure storage solution.Eco-Friendly: Can be repurposed, lowering waste and consumption of new products.Downsides to Consider
While there are many advantages, potential users should also be conscious of some downsides:
Limited Insulation: Standard containers might require extra insulation for temperature-sensitive products.Rust and Corrosion: If not effectively kept, containers can rust with time.Regulative Restrictions: Depending on the place, zoning laws might impact where containers can be put.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How much does a 20-foot shipping container weigh?
The average weight of a basic 20-foot shipping container is around 2,300 kg (5,071 pounds), while the maximum gross weight can reach roughly 24,000 kg (52,910 pounds), depending on the cargo.
2. Can I customize a 20-foot shipping container?
Yes, 20-foot shipping containers can be modified for a variety of usages, consisting of producing windows, doors, and insulation for residential or industrial purposes.

4. Are 20-foot containers weatherproof?
Yes, they are created to be weather-resistant, but for outright defense versus the aspects, additional sealing or lining might be suggested depending upon the contents.
5. What are the average costs of purchasing or leasing a 20-foot shipping container?
The expense can vary commonly based upon condition (20ft New Shipping Container vs. utilized), modifications, and area, but normally, costs vary from ₤ 1,500 to ₤ 5,000 to acquire and ₤ 100 to ₤ 200 a month to lease.
6. How do I transport a 20-foot shipping container?
Containers can be transferred using flatbed trucks, cranes, and ships. For much heavier loads, it's a good idea to utilize specialized transportation services.
